New operator in place at the car terminal

Apr 13, 2011 Port

On April 4, the Swedish logistics company Logent took over operations at the Car Terminal at the Port of Gothenburg. At the same time, the new president Michael Arvidsson took up his position and the name was changed to Logent Gothenburg Car Terminal AB.


Plans are already in place to increase import flows and improve rail links.


"With improved rail links, we will satisfy our customers' needs and create better conditions for the transport industry. At the same time, we will take responsibility for the environment by reducing the volume of road transport," states new president Michael Arvidsson.


When it comes to import flows, Logent can see growth potential.
"We have a firm belief in the future and an advantage for us is that we are a neutral player,which means we can attract different customers. We intend to make use of our excellent network of contacts in the industry and we are already talking to other parties in the chain with the aim of putting together what will be a very interesting offer," states Michael Arvidsson.


The Port of Gothenburg is by far the largest port of export for cars in Sweden. Swedish export successes such as construction machinery, truck chassis and bus chassis are also shipped through the port. Direct routes to other parts of the world make Gothenburg an important gateway for the Swedish automotive industry.
